directions

  • Marinate shrimp with garlic, for at least 10 minutes.
  • If using bamboo sticks, soak in water for 30 minutes before putting on BBQ, so they don't burn as easily.
  • String all vegetables together on skewers.
  • String the tofu, and shrimp on other skewers together, as they will cook the soonest.
  • Place skewers of food on BBQ.
